The hottest day should be Saturday with a high of 94. Windy? Yes, but not enough to produce blowing dust. Here's your exclusive 9-Hour Forecast for Saturday:
TONIGHT: The skies will be clear, and the winds will be light out of the SE at 5-10 mph. The low will be a mild 59 at the airpor
t, 54 in the valley.
FORECAST: High pressure reaches its maximum on Saturday, and record warmth will follow us into the weekend. Saturday will be sunny and windy. The SW winds will gust near 30 mph, below the level to produce any blowing dust. With a high of 94, Saturday will probably break the record of 90 set in 2018. Sunday will also be flirting with record heat. Sunday's high will be 92, and the record is 92 set in 2018. Sunday will be partly cloudy with moderate winds from the SW, which will gust near 35 mph. It should be just below the level needed for a dusty haze. Monday will be mostly cloudy with lighter winds and a high of 86. Tuesday will be partly to mostly cloudy with a slight chance of isolated area t-storms (non-severe). Tuesday's high: 88. Wednesday will be sunny with moderate winds. The SW winds will gust near 35 mph, which may produce a very slight dusty haze. Wednesday's high: 89. Thursday will be partly cloudy and moderately windy with a high of 88. Good Friday will be partly to mostly cloudy with a slight chance of isolated (non-severe) t-storms. Friday's high: 86.
